How do you turn off Progressive scan mode?
Posted by Chewbacarules on March 30, 2006 at 9:57 pmHey,
I mistakenly turned Progressive scan mode “ON” on my Zenith Dual DVD VHS combo and I can’t turn it off. It won’t play video, I only get audio. I can’t get the blue screen that reads “Progressive Scan Mode ON” off my television. To my understanding, progressive scan is used for component video or s-video. How do I fix it?

March 31, 2006 at 4:52 pmOh dear! You got yourself in a pickle. As I understand it you turned on progressive scan in the menu and now you can’t turn it off because you can’t even see the menu? I just love technology!
1. Well, does the manual mention anything about a way to reset the machine to the factory default setup? Maybe there’s a small hole in the back panel with a reset button hiding under it.
2. Do you have a friend or neighbor with a progressive scan TV that you could hook your machine to temporarily to change the menu back to interlaced?
3. Is there a progressive/interlaced button hiding on the remote for your machine?
4. How about calling the factory support number or website in the manual. They would certainly know how to solve your problem.
I hope some of this points you in the right direction.

April 10, 2006 at 2:36 amChewy,
I just found this online and it worked! let me know if you need more clarifcation…thanks!
Put a disc in the DVD and press play. Pointing the remote at the player, press the STOP key to stop any disc that is playing. Next, press the STOP key again and hold it for five
seconds before releasing it. This should turn the Progressive Scan
off.Bye!
